Fear Of Having A Baby

Fear of having a baby is called Tokophobia, and one in six women suffer from it.

Sufferers of Tokophobia are split into two groups, and quite often starts with feelings of anxiety and terror due to early and ongoing programming concerning horrors of labour, negative anticipation created through media drama, stories of earlier births, films showing labour to be comic or very dangerous, or having had a bad experience the first time round, the more you think about it the worse the feeling of terror becomes. If you can learn to let go of the fear, use breathing and relaxation techniques, the uterus can do its work easily and comfortably, as it is meant to do, in a normal birth.

How To Secure Your Wireless Broadband

Wireless broadband is fast becoming the most popular way to connect to the internet. With most broadband providers now offering packages that include a free wireless router or one at discounted price, and most laptops now come with an integrated wireless receiver. This makes the ideal opportunity to take advantage of wireless broadband.

Wireless broadband works by your router sending a signal throughout your house and beyond; it doesn’t just stop at where your laptop is. With an indoor range of around 30-45 metres, this signal may be picked up by your neighbour too, allowing them to benefit from your broadband.

Celebrate Saint Nicholas Day In Curacao

Each December in the ABC Islands - Aruba, Bonaire and Curacao - locals and tourists celebrate the traditional Dutch holiday known as Saint Nicholas Day. Throughout the weeks leading up to the feast day on December 5, Sinterklaas - the Dutch precursor to the American Santa Claus - makes appearances throughout the islands and distributes gifts. Much like the Christmas season in America, the weeks surrounding Saint Nicholas Day are a very exciting time for Curacao and her sister islands.
